Warning Signs You Need Window Leak Water Removal

Ignoring the warning signs of window leak water damage can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Look out for these common signs: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. Don’t ignore these smells, as they can spread quickly and cause serious health issues.

Warped or Discolored Flooring

Water damage can cause your flooring to warp or discolor.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s essential to address the issue quickly.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Water damage can cause paint or wallpaper to peel or bubble. This is a sign that moisture has penetrated the surface and can lead to further damage if left unchecked.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

Water stains on your ceilings or walls can show a leaky window or other water damage issue.

Visible Signs of Mold or Mildew

Mold and mildew can grow quickly in damp environments. If you notice any visible signs of these growths, it’s essential to address the issue immediately.

Unusual Sounds or Squeaks

Unusual sounds or squeaks from your windows or surrounding areas can show a leak or other water damage issue.

Window Leak Water Removal Cost in Kingwood, TX

The cost of window le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Kingwood, TX.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500, but this can vary depending on the specifics of your situ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Containment $100-$500 Size of affected area, complexity of issue
Water Removal $200-$1,000 Amount of water, equ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$300-$1,500 Size of affected area, duration of drying process
Cleaning and Disinfecting $100-$500 Size of affected area, level of contamination
Restoration and Repair $500-$2,500 Size of affected area, complexity of repairs

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to ensure you understand the costs involved.
